There's definitely a big problem with entry-level jobs being replaced by AI. Why hire an intern or a recent college-grad when they lack both the expertise and experience to do what an AI could probably do?
Sure, the AI might require handholding and prompting too, but the AI is either cheaper or actually "smarter" than the young person. In many cases, it's both. I work with some people who I believe have the capacity and potential to one day be competent, but the time and resource investment to make that happen is too much. I often find myself choosing to just use an AI for work I would have delegated to them, because I need it fast and I need it now. If I handed it off to them I would not get it fast, and I would need to also go through it with them in several back-and-forth feedback-review loops to get it to a state that's usable.
Given they are human, this would push back delivery times by 2-3 business days. Or... I can prompt and handhold an AI to get it done in 3 hours.
Not that I'm saying AI is a god-send, but new grads and entry-level roles are kind of screwed.

- nradov 1y agoSure, but no one has found a good metric for actually quantifying quality for surgeons. You can't look at just the rate of positive outcomes because often the best surgeons take on the worst cases that others won't even attempt. And we simply don't have enough reliable data to make proper metric adjustments based on individual patient attributes.

- alephnerd 1y agoIt's a monetary issue at the end of the day. AI/ML and Offshoring/GCCs are both side effects of the fact that American new grad salaries in tech are now in the $110-140k range. At $70-80k the math for a new grad works out, but not at almost double that. Also, going remote first during COVID for extended periods proved that operations can work in a remote first manner, so at that point the argument was made that you can hire top talent at American new grad salaries abroad, and plenty of employees on visas were given the option to take a pay cut and "remigrate" to help start a GCC in their home country or get fired and try to find a job in 60 days around early-mid 2020. The skills aspect also played a role to a certain extent - by the late 2010s it was getting hard to find new grads who actually understood systems internals and OS/architecture concepts, so a lot of jobs adjacent to those ended up moving abroad to Israel, India, and Eastern Europe where universities still treat CS as engineering instead of an applied math disciple - I don't care if you can prove Dixon's factorization method using induction if you can't tell me how threading works or the rings in the Linux kernel. - sarchertech 1y ago> by the late 2010s it was getting hard to find new grads who actually understood systems internals and OS/architecture concepts, so a lot of jobs adjacent to those ended up moving abroad to Israel, India, and Eastern Europe where universities still treat CS as engineering instead of an applied math disciple That doesn’t fit my experience at all. The applied math vs engineering continuum is mostly dependent on whether a CS program at a given school came out of the engineering department or the math apartment. I haven’t noticed any shift on that spectrum coming from CS departments except that people are more likely to start out programming in higher level languages where they are more insulated from the hardware. That’s the same across countries though. I certainly haven’t noticed that Indian or Eastern European CS grads have a better understanding of the OS or the underlying hardware.

- diogolsq 1y agoYou’re right that AI is fast and often more efficient than entry-level humans for certain tasks — but I’d argue that what you’re describing isn’t delegation, it’s just choosing to do the work yourself via a tool. Implementation costs are lower now, so you decide to do it on your own. Delegation, properly defined, involves transferring not just the task but the judgment and ownership of its outcome. The perfect delegation is when you delegate to someone because you trust them to make decisions the way you would — or at least in a way you respect and understand. You can’t fully delegate to AI — and frankly, you shouldn’t. AI requires prompting, interpretation, and post-processing. That’s still you doing the thinking. The implementation cost is low, sure, but the decision-making cost still sits with you. That’s not delegation; it’s assisted execution. Humans, on the other hand, can be delegated to — truly. Because over time, they internalize your goals, adapt to your context, and become accountable in a way AI never can. Many reasons why AI can't fill your shoes: 1. Shallow context – It lacks awareness of organizational norms, unspoken expectations, or domain-specific nuance that’s not in the prompt or is not explicit in the code base. 2. No skin in the game – AI doesn’t have a career, reputation, or consequences. A junior human, once trained and trusted, becomes not only faster but also independently responsible. Junior and Interns can also use AI tools.

- uludag 1y agoI thought the whole idea of automation though was to lower the skill requirement. Everyone compares AI to the industrial revolution and the shift from artisan work to factory work. If this analogy were to hold true, then what employers should actually be wanting is more junior devs, maybe even non-devs, hired at a much cheaper wage. A senior dev may be able to outperform a junior by a lot, but assuming the AI is good enough, four juniors or like 10 non-devs should be able to outperform a senior. This obviously not being the case shows that we're not in a AI driven fundamental paradigm shift, but rather run of the mill cost cutting measures.
